Alpha1971 wrote:What has been the biggest difference so far for the Knicks against the Celts, regular season and the playoffs ?

The biggest difference is the defensive strategy. Knicks employed a drop coverage defense all season long. Minnesota writers warned if Knicks employed KAT in drop he will get slaughtered and he does. It’s widely known the only way to slow down Boston offense is through heavy switch defense. Knicks rarely ever do it so most were skeptical Thibs would do it. But Thibs has done exactly that and it’s something he didn’t do all year long. I honestly think he saved true game to game defensive strategy for playoffs and just has a sustainable and consistent model to get through the grind of the season. Boston is currently baffled by the Knicks defense and it’s leading to more isolation pull up 3s from guys like Derrick White than they want to take.
